What Does a Water Test Actually Measure?
Water quality cannot be represented accurately by a single number.
Different parameters provide different pieces of information.
| Parameter | Information Provided |
| pH | Acidic or alkaline characteristics |
| TDS | Overall concentration of dissolved solids |
| Hardness | Hardness associated primarily with calcium and magnesium |
| Turbidity | Suspended matter affecting clarity |
| Chloride | Chloride concentration |
| Nitrate | Nitrate concentration |
| Fluoride | Fluoride concentration |
| Iron | Amount of iron in the sample |
| Alkalinity | Ability of water to neutralise acids |
| Microbiological indicators | Information relating to microbial quality |
Other parameters may be selected depending on the water source, intended use and applicable requirements.
The TDS Myth: One Reading Does Not Tell the Whole Story
TDS meters have made basic water monitoring convenient, but they have also created a common misunderstanding.
A TDS reading is not a complete water-quality report.
A handheld TDS meter provides an estimate related to dissolved substances. It generally does not tell you which individual substances are contributing to that reading.
It also does not replace microbiological analysis.
Therefore, professional water testing in Delhi should be based on the actual purpose of testing rather than relying solely on a TDS value.
Drinking Water and Industrial Water Are Not Tested for the Same Reason
The meaning of “good water” changes according to its application.
For Drinking
The focus may include relevant physical, chemical and microbiological characteristics.
For Manufacturing
Water may need specific properties so that it does not adversely influence processes or products.
For Boilers
Hardness and other characteristics associated with deposits and operational efficiency can become important.
For Cooling Systems
Water chemistry can influence scaling, deposits and corrosion-related conditions.
For Wastewater
Testing may focus on treatment performance and parameters relevant to environmental requirements.
This is why telling the laboratory how the water will be used is essential.

Sample Collection Can Make or Break the Test
Suppose you want to investigate water stored in a building’s overhead tank but collect your sample directly from the incoming supply before it reaches that tank.
The laboratory may analyse the sample perfectly, but the result does not necessarily represent the water you intended to investigate.
Good sampling is therefore fundamental.
Basic Sampling Practices
Use a suitable container, select a representative sampling location, avoid touching the inside of the bottle or cap, label samples properly and follow the laboratory’s transportation and preservation instructions.
Microbiological Samples Need Extra Care
Microbiological analysis can be particularly sensitive to collection and transportation conditions. The laboratory’s sampling instructions should therefore be followed carefully.
